Geographic Coverage:
Geographic Description: The Bonney meteorology station is located at a latitude of 77 50.981 S, a longitude of 162 27.84968 E, and an elevation of 64.43 meters above sea level. Descriptions of this and other McMurdo Dry Valley meteorology stations can be found at http://www.mcmlter.org/data/meteorology/locations/metlocs.html.
